Step In Limited versus Dar es Salaam Institute of Technology

Step In Limited versus Dar es Salaam Institute of Technology; MISC Commercial Cause No 328 of 2015: High Court of Tanzania (Commercial Division) at Dar es Salaam (Unreported).

  • Court of Appeal Rules
  • Leave to appeal – what are the grounds / factors the High court should take into consideration before granting an application for leave to appeal?

Held:-

(i) Leave is grantable where the proposed appeal stands reasonable chances of success or where, but not necessarily, the proceedings as a whole reveal such disturbing features as to require the guidance of the Court of Appeal.

(ii) The purpose of the provision is therefore to spare the court the spectre of unmeriting matters and to enable it to give adequate attention to cases of true public importance.
